What Types of Private Label Products Does Walmart Offer?

Walmart Private Label

Walmart has established an extensive range of private label products that cater to various market segments. Ready for the good part? Let’s explore the key categories of Walmart’s private label offerings. These include food items, household goods, health and wellness products, clothing, and more.

Walmart’s private label food products prominently feature brands like Great Value, which delivers everything from canned goods to snacks, such as Great Value snacks. The popularity of these items reinforces the concept that consumers are increasingly willing to purchase private label groceries, provided they offer comparable quality to national brands. Additionally, Walmart’s Sam’s Choice brand targets consumers looking for premium food options, bolstering Walmart’s appeal in higher-end markets.

Walmart also capitalizes on its private label strategy in the household goods sector, offering walmart private label home goods such as cleaning supplies, kitchenware, and personal care items. This assortment ensures that customers can find everything they need under Walmart’s brands without compromising quality. Moreover, the presence of walmart private label clothing lines allows shoppers to find fashionable and affordable apparel options, making Walmart not just a grocery destination but also a go-to retail hub for varied needs.

Furthermore, Walmart has extended its reach into health and wellness with Equate, a private label offering a diverse selection of health products, ranging from over-the-counter medications to personal care items. This diversification is key to ensuring that Walmart’s private label portfolio encompasses products that fulfill consumers’ everyday needs.

How Do Walmart’s Private Label Brands Compare to Competitors?

Walmart’s private label strategy is often compared against competitors like Costco and Target. What’s the takeaway? Each retailer adopts unique approaches to private labels, and understanding these differences provides critical insights. Walmart emphasizes affordability and quality, making its private labels attractive to budget-conscious shoppers.

In contrast, Costco focuses heavily on bulk sales, providing consumers with significant value through large quantities at lower prices. While Walmart markets quality at affordability, Costco enhances the overall experience through membership models and limited-edition offerings.

Target, on the other hand, employs a distinct branding strategy that emphasizes fashion and lifestyle. Target’s private label brands, such as Up & Up and Cat & Jack, not only offer value but also focus on aesthetics and trendiness, attracting a different demographic.

This differentiation highlights how Walmart’s strategy revolves around capturing a vast consumer base with essential yet affordable products, while competitors like Target cater to those looking for fashion-forward items. The competition among these retail giants ultimately leads to enhanced consumer options, driving innovations that benefit shoppers across the board.

How Does Walmart’s Private Label Strategy Affect Suppliers?

The relationship between Walmart and its suppliers is complex and nuanced. But here’s the kicker: suppliers experience both opportunities and challenges when engaging with Walmart’s private label strategy. On the one hand, securing a partnership through private label manufacturing for Walmart can offer suppliers significant volume and market exposure. Many suppliers see this as a solid avenue for growth, thanks to Walmart’s extensive customer base and brand reputation.

However, competition among suppliers for Walmart’s attention can be intense. This demand often means that suppliers must adhere to strict guidelines and quality standards stipulated in Walmart’s compliance requirements for Walmart vendors. Meeting these criteria is vital, meaning suppliers must invest in quality control processes, robust logistics, and the capacity to scale production.

Working with Walmart often entails navigating complex negotiations. Exclusive brand agreements might be required, limiting suppliers’ ability to work with competitors. While this can lead to increased profits for suppliers, it also constrains their flexibility in product development and marketing initiatives.

Moreover, commitment to consistency and quality poses a challenge for many suppliers. Maintaining quality across large production runs is essential, as any lapse could jeopardize the partnerships and Walmart’s brand reputation. Therefore, commitment to excellence is key for suppliers looking to thrive in this competitive landscape.
